Russia's Putin tells Germany's Scholz: Ukraine should fulfil Russian demands

Russian President Vladimir Putin told German Chancellor Olaf Scholz in a call on Friday that while Russia is open for dialogue with Ukraine, the country should fulfill all Russian demands, reported Reuters citing Russia's Interfax. Putin also reportedly told Scholz that he hopes Kyiv will adopt a more constructive position in the next rounds of talks. Scholz reportedly told Putin that he is concerned by reports of civilian casualties.
